Is an open-source overlay and peer-to-peer network simulation framework for the OMNeT simulation environment. The simulator contains several models for structured (e.g. Chord, Kademlia, Pastry) and unstructured (e.g. GIA) P2P systems and overlay protocols. A Secure Distributed Name Service for P2PSIP. The experimental P2PNS implementation consists of two parts: A modified OpenSER SIP proxy and the overlay framework. The SIP proxy connects to the OverSim P2PNS service via an XML-RPC interface. The implementation is still in an early stage and several security mechanisms described in the. Are not implemented yet. This page shows the current implementation status:. Various KBR protocols: Chord, Koorde, Pastry, Bamboo, Kademlia, Broose.

A Secure Distributed Name Service for P2PSIP. Peer-to-Peer Name Service) is a distributed name service using a peer-to-peer network. The current focus of P2PNS is to provide a secure and efficient SIP name resolution for decentralized VoIP (. P2PNS is developed at the. At Karlsruhe Institute of Technology (KIT).
